3 Ways to Get Confident on Camera

“I hate my voice. I am bad on camera. I look bad on video.” So many people come to me saying some version of this. It’s okay if you’re feeling slightly nervous to be on camera. But you can’t let that stop you.

I’ve been coaching people to be on camera for live TV for over 20 years and now coach business owners, real estate agents coaches and consultants to get confident for video and stages. 

Here are 3 ways to feel more confident on camera:

1: Wear something you feel great in. It’s an instant confident boost - whether that means a great outfit, makeup, or your lucky shirt.

2: We live in what I call “Supermodel Mode”: we feel like there’s a spotlight on us. Shift your mindset to “Teacher Mode” where you’re focused on the message!

3: Practice. It takes repetition to get good - you are building a new muscle.
